Responsibilities

  • Ultimate accountability for the sales, market share, shrink and EBIT of a category(ies) across all formats.
  • Understanding and driving their business end-to-end from strategy to tactics.
  • Coaching, mentoring and developing their team and provide them direction in planning, vendor management, product assortment, space allocations, pricing and promotion in support of overall group objectives and all functions that impact financial objectives.
  • Liaising with various internal and external stakeholders and teams in order to achieve category objectives, including but not limited to Marketing, Finance, Promotions & Allocations, Brands, Operations & Vendors.
  • Ensuring team of Category Directors’ product assortment, sales and buying plans are in place to support the achievement of individual category and roll up targets.
  • Developing, monitoring and managing within annual category budgets in order to achieve national category P&L and GMROI for assigned category(ies), including inventory carrying costs.
  • Responsible for weekly Category reports and LE’s by category including Other Vendor Income.
  • Implementing product assortment, sales and buying plans, while advocating for their customers’ needs, in order to achieve category targets and review implementation throughout the year, adjusting as required to meet targets.
  • Working with control label brand team to develop innovative and differentiated products that grow the brand and help to achieve overall strategy, sales and market share.
  • Delivering against control label objectives in order to achieve annual sales, market share and profit objectives.
  • Developing and communicating merchandising direction for each retail format for assigned category(ies).
  • Developing and implementing promotions and programs for the assigned category(ies).
  • Leading weekly store tours.
  • Coaching, developing and mentoring direct reports. This includes explicit consideration of on-the-job training needs for each colleague, arranging appropriate training, providing timely feedback and overseeing colleague development.
  • Collaboratively planning activities and developing strong relationships with the vendor community in order to maximize sales & profit.
  • Building strong, collaborative relationships and leveraging all key stakeholders to invest in their business for growth ahead of market.
  • Taking full ownership of all key decisions and results, having a passion for their business and a desire to develop their team to similar vision.
  • Attending and participating in other meetings as required (JBP, Merch Readiness, Blue Print to Sell, IR etc.).
